Never share your national identity card (NIC) details, banking information, or intimate media with unverified contacts online. If you have fallen victim to an online scam or extortion attempt in Sri Lanka, you can report the incident securely to the Sri Lanka Computer Emergency Readiness Team (Sri Lanka CERT) or file a complaint with the Criminal Investigation Department (CID) Cyber Crime Division.
